For the beginner investor, navigating the realm of assets can feel complicated. Let's examine three popular options: stocks, ETFs, and cryptocurrencies. Stocks represent ownership in some business, while ETFs offer diversification across several companies. Lastly, crypto are digital tokens with significant uncertainty and potential. Comparing Virtual ETFs and Individual Equity Investment
When thinking about entering the crypto market, investors often grapple whether to opt for a crypto ETF or a straight share holding. ETFs offer ready-made access to a basket of crypto currencies and typically have lower requirements, while a direct share purchase grants a trader ownership in a specific virtual company, potentially delivering greater rewards, but also involving increased risk. In conclusion, the preferred approach varies based on a trader's individual risk tolerance and investment goals.
